推荐开源项目:Plug-N-Meet - 高性能的在线会议系统
在数字化时代,高效的远程协作工具是必不可少的。今天,我们向您推荐一个卓越的开源项目——Plug-N-Meet,一个基于WebRTC技术的可扩展、高性能的网络会议系统。这个创新的平台不仅提供了丰富的功能,而且易于集成和定制,无论您是个人用户还是企业,都能从中受益。
项目介绍
Plug-N-Meet 是一个由Go语言编写的单二进制文件服务器,其核心构建于高性能的Livekit之上。它提供了一个全设备兼容的界面,包括谷歌Chrome、火狐浏览器,以及iOS上的Safari。此外,该项目还拥有活跃的社区支持,您可以在Slack上加入讨论组以提出建议或报告问题。
技术分析
Plug-N-Meet 利用了WebRTC的技术,确保了安全加密的通信。通过Go语言的强大功能,实现了分布式部署,并且可以作为一个单独的二进制文件运行,这极大地简化了安装和维护过程。此外,它支持Simulcast和Dynacast特性,即使在网络不稳定的情况下也能保证流畅的视频通话。该系统还支持多种视频编码器,如H264、VP8、VP9和AV1。
应用场景
无论是教育领域进行线上课程,企业举办远程会议,或是团队进行跨地域协作,Plug-N-Meet 都能胜任。它的功能丰富,包括高清音视频、屏幕共享、虚拟背景、白板协作、投票、等待室、锁定控制、分组讨论等,完全满足各种在线交流需求。
项目特点
- 全平台兼容 - 支持多种浏览器和设备。
- WebRTC保障的加密通信 - 保护您的信息安全。
- 轻量级部署 - 只需一个二进制文件,轻松启动。
- 适应性传输 - Simulcast和Dynacast在低带宽下也可保持流畅。
- 易集成与定制 - 轻松嵌入现有网站或系统,自由调整品牌元素。
- 强大功能集 - 包括虚拟背景、白板、笔记、录制等。
- 端到端加密 - 提供E2EE选项,增强数据安全性。
尝试与参与
想要体验Plug-N-Meet 的魅力,可以访问Demo。或者直接从GitHub获取源代码,按照提供的安装指南快速安装。
让我们一起加入Plug-N-Meet,享受无缝、高效且安全的在线协作体验吧!如果有任何疑问或建议,欢迎通过Slack社区与开发者们交流互动。